Noun

softly-softly noun

  1. (western or central Africa) The potto, Perodicticus potto, a primate in the family Lorisidae.

Verb

No verb senses have been added yet.

Adjective

softly-softly adjective

  1. (often hyphenated) Discreet, low-key, careful.
